>> I found odd that you can select a paragraph or sentence and apply a
>> specific style, but you cant select a page and apply a specific style,
>> is there a way that this can be done?
>>
>
> No. Writer is not a DPT program like Scribus (page layout based), but use
> the paradigm of content flow where pages are just a "content containment".
> Pages are not "objects" by itself so you cannot select them: it is possible
> to classify them with page styles, and group them with page breaks, but
> nothing else. Note that this behaviour is not either wrong nor right, it's
> just a different way of thinking documents. Writer is best suited when
> automated formatting (text books with lots of headings, for example) is
> possible, Scribus is best suited when direct control (magazines,
> photography books...) of layout elements is a must. For each need, a tool
> ;)

>> > Please, note that on Writer there is no direct formatting for pages,
>> > they
>> > can only be formatted through page styles. To insert a different page
>> > layout between two other pages you need to insert two page breaks with
>> > change of page style.
